During the 2020-2021 academic year, Saint Michael's College handed out 20 bachelor's degrees in political science & government. This is a decrease of 5% over the previous year when 21 degrees were handed out.

How Much Do Political Science Graduates from Saint Michael's Make?

$30,772 Bachelor's Median Salary

Salary of Political Science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

The median salary of political science students who receive their bachelor's degree at Saint Michael's is $30,772. Unfortunately, this is lower than the national average of $33,089 for all political science students.

How Much Student Debt Do Political Science Graduates from Saint Michael's Have?

$27,000 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of Political Science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

While getting their bachelor's degree at Saint Michael's, political science students borrow a median amount of $27,000 in student loans. This is higher than the the typical median of $24,439 for all political science majors across the country.

Political Science Student Diversity at Saint Michael's

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the political science majors at Saint Michael’s College.

Saint Michael’s Political Science & Government Bachelor’s Program

In the 2020-2021 academic year, 20 students earned a bachelor's degree in political science from Saint Michael's. About 55% of these graduates were women and the other 45% were men.

undefined

The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at Saint Michael's are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 75% of students fell into this category.
